Sylvia Louella Waddell age 77 went Home to rest on August 8, 2018 at her home in the Sprouts Creek section of Rich Valley, VA.


She was the third daughter of William “Bill” & Susie Strouth. Along with her parents, she is also preceded in death by her sisters Darlene Shultz and Maxie Anderson & husband Buddy; three brothers Johnny, Wayne, & Ronnie Strouth.


She was a faithful mommy, maw maw, Granny Sylvia, and great grandmother. She enjoyed traveling thru the years along beside her husband who served in the United States Military. She was property manager for their numerous rental properties around Smyth County. Sylvia was a faithful member of the Goodman’s Chapel as well as the Bland Chapter of the Order of the Eastern Star. She also enjoyed quilting, working in her garden, and watching her hummingbirds.


She is survived by her husband of 60years Harold Waddell of the home; two sons Anthony Waddell & Sherry, and Michael Waddell & Rosetta; daughter Michele Wagoner of Troy, VA; faithful sister Shirley Cassell & husband Woody; seven grandchildren, 11 assorted great grandchildren, several nieces, nephews, and other loving family, and her pet companion WuWu.


The family would like to express a special Thanks to all emergency services that helped Mrs. Waddell & the family.


Funeral services will be held at 1:00PM on Friday August 10, 2018 from the Bradley’s Funeral Home Chapel in Marion with Pastor Larry Patton officiating. Interment will follow in the Ridgedale Cemetery in Rich Valley. The family will receive friends from 11:00-1:00PM on Friday at the funeral home.
